What is Drug Possession?
Drug possession is the criminal act of having an illegal drug in your possession
or having drug paraphernalia in your possession. Even if a person has a small
amount of a narcotic in their possession, he/she can be charged with drug possession
by California law enforcement. A person can be charged with drug possession
if he/she has any amount of marijuana, heroin, cocaine, LSD, methamphetamine, Ecstasy,
or unauthorized prescription medication, such as Oxycontin, in his/her possession.
Drug possession is a serious crime and should never be taken lightly. This
is especially true if the person is charged with drug possession during a traffic
stop.

Drug Possession Consequences
The legal penalties for drug possession vary and will depend upon several factors,
including: the type of drug possessed, the amount of the drug possessed, the
offender’s prior criminal history, and if the offender has prior drug possession
charges. These circumstances will determine if the offender is charged with
a misdemeanor or felony drug offense. If the offender has a prior criminal
record or a prior drug possession charge, he/she is likely to receive an enhanced
sentence if he/she is convicted.
After a person has been convicted of drug possession in Orange County, he/she may
be punished with: imprisonment, jail time, large fines, loss of driver’s license,
seizure of personal assets, house arrest, probation, and court ordered treatment
programs. Additionally, any person that is convicted of a drug crime in the
state of California will have to register his/her self as a drug offender.
Once a person is a registered drug offender, he/she may find it difficult to attain
employment or housing opportunities. The person may also lose their right
to obtain student or bank loans from financial institutions.
